Scope

This document specifies the technical requirements, sampling, testing methods, inspection rules, marking, packaging, transportation, and storage requirements for carbon monoxide. This document is applicable to carbon monoxide used in electronics, which is prepared by purification of industrial-grade carbon monoxide.
